Masaka businessman Emmanuel Lwasa, who once dated singer Desire Luzinda, has sent her a warm message after hearing about her engagement to gospel singer Levixone.

In a short video, Lwasa said, “Desire, I wish you a happy marriage,” and jokingly added, “Take care of your man like you took care of me.”

His message has brought back memories of their past relationship, which lasted about five years before he left Desire for TV personality Dianah Nabatanzi.

In several interviews, Lwasa has admitted that he regrets leaving Desire, saying that Nabatanzi may have influenced his decision by saying negative things about her.

Despite everything, Lwasa says there’s no bad blood between him and Desire. His recent video shows that he’s letting the past go—and is happy for her new beginning.
